반응형

2021/06 4

HTML5 Input file 파일 업로드 버튼 제거 또는 커스텀 CSS

HTML에서 Input type file시 기본적으로 생성해주는 파일 업로드 버튼이 마음에 안드셨을겁니다. 파일 업로드 버튼을 커스텀 하기 위해 Input type file을 만들고, label로 Input file을 제어하는 경우가 많을 겁니다. 이러한 경우에는 가상 요소 선택자 file-selector-button을 사용하면 됩니다. 아래 테스트 예제를 보시죠 파일 업로드 기본적인 파일 업로드 예제입니다. 예제의 결과는 이런식으로 나옵니다. 여기서 input에 가상요소선택자 file-selector-button를 사용하면, 원하는 모양 또는 제거할 수 있습니다. 파일 업로드 이런식으로 CSS를 통해 Input Button을 커스텀 할 수 있습니다. https://developer.mozilla.org..

Develop/HTML·CSS 2021.06.23

Node js NVM을 이용한 설치

Node js란 ? Node.js는 Chrome V8 JavaScript 엔진으로 빌드된 JavaScript 런타임입니다. Mac OS용 오픈 소스 소프트웨어 패키지 관리 시스템중 하나인 Homebrew를 사용하여 설치합니다. 설치 방법은 https://seungjuv.tistory.com/3 Homebrew 설치하기 Homebrew란 ? Homebrew는 Mac OS용 오픈 소스 소프트웨어 패키지 관리 시스템의 하나로서 Mac OS 운영체제의 소프트웨어 설치를 단순하게 만들어주는 소프트웨어입니다. Homebrew는 Ruby언어로 개발되었으 seungjuv.tistory.com 을 참고해주세요. 먼저 node가 설치되어 있는지 확인합니다. $ node -v bash: node: command not fo..

Develop/Node js 2021.06.20

requests 라이브러리 사용법

requests란 ? requests는 Python 용 HTTP 라이브러리 입니다. 패키지 설치 python의 패키지 매니저인 pip를 이용해서 requests 패키지를 설치합니다. $ pip install requests 설치가 잘 되었는지 파이썬 인터프리터를 실행하여 확인해봅니다. $ python >>> import requests >>> requests.get("https://seungjuv.tistory.com") # requests 라이브러리를 사용하여 블로그에 접속해보니 상태 코드 200이 응답되는 것을 확인할 수 있습니다. API requests 라이브러리는 심플하고 직관적인 API를 제공하는데요, 어떤 HTTP의 Method를 요청하느냐에 따라서 해당되는 Method의 함수를 사용하면 됩니..

Develop/Python 2021.06.20

Homebrew 설치하기

Homebrew란 ? Homebrew는 Mac OS용 오픈 소스 소프트웨어 패키지 관리 시스템의 하나로서 Mac OS 운영체제의 소프트웨어 설치를 단순하게 만들어주는 소프트웨어입니다. Homebrew는 Ruby언어로 개발되었으며, 2009년에 처음 릴리즈 되었습니다. Homebrew 설치하기 $ brew --version Homebrew가 설치되어있는지 확인합니다. $ bash: brew: command not found 설치가 되어있지 않다면, $ /b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)" 이 명령어를 통해 설치해주도록 합니다. 설치가 완료되었다면 다시한번 $ brew --v..

Develop/Mac 2021.06.20
반응형